Table Of ContentContents Note: Each chapter concludes with a Chapter Summary, Review Exercises, a Chapter Test, Proofs in Mathematics, and P.S. Problem Solving. 1. Functions and Their Graphs 1.1 Rectangular Coordinates 1.2 Graphs of Equations 1.3 Linear Equations in Two Variables 1.4 Functions 1.5 Analyzing Graphs of Functions 1.6 A Library of Parent Functions 1.7 Transformations of Functions 1.8 Combinations of Functions: Composite Functions 1.9 Inverse Functions 1.10 Mathematical Modeling and Variation 2. Polynomial and Rational Functions 2.1 Quadratic Functions and Models 2.2 Polynomial Functions of Higher Degree 2.3 Polynomial and Synthetic Division 2.4 Complex Numbers 2.5 Zeros of Polynomial Functions 2.6 Rational Functions 2.7 Nonlinear Inequalities 3. Exponential and Logarithmic Functions 3.1 Exponential Functions and Their Graphs 3.2 Logarithmic Functions and Their Graphs 3.3 Properties of Logarithms 3.4 Exponential and Logarithmic Equations 3.5 Exponential and Logarithmic Models Cumulative Test: Chapters 1–3 4. Trigonometry 4.1 Radian and Degree Measure 4.2 Trigonometric Functions: The Unit Circle 4.3 Right Triangle Trigonometry 4.4 Trigonometric Functions of Any Angle 4.5 Graphs of Sine and Cosine Functions 4.6 Graphs of Other Trigonometric Functions 4.7 Inverse Trigonometric Functions 4.8 Applications and Models 5. Analytic Trigonometry 5.1 Using Fundamental Identities 5.2 Verifying Trigonometric Identities 5.3 Solving Trigonometric Equations 5.4 Sum and Difference Formulas 5.5 Multiple-Angle and Product-to-Sum Formulas 6. Additional Topics in Trigonometery 6.1 Law of Sines 6.2 Law of Cosines 6.3 Vectors in the Plane 6.4 Vectors and Dot Products 6.5 Trigonometric Form of a Complex Number Cumulative Test: Chapters 4–6 7. Systems of Equations and Inequalities 7.1 Linear and Nonlinear Systems of Equations 7.2 Two-Variable Linear Systems 7.3 Multivariable Linear Systems 7.4 Partial Fractions 7.5 Systems of Inequalities 7.6 Linear Programming 8. Matrices and Determinants 8.1 Matrices and Systems of Equations 8.2 Operations with Matrices 8.3 The Inverse of a Square Matrix 8.4 The Determinant of a Square Matrix 8.5 Applications of Matrices and Determinants 9. Sequences, Series, and Probability 9.1 Sequences and Series 9.2 Arithmetic Sequences and Partial Sums 9.3 Geometric Sequences and Series 9.4 Mathematical Induction 9.5 The Binomial Theorem 9.6 Counting Principles 9.7 Probability Cumulative Test: Chapters 7–9 10. Topics in Analytic Geometry 10.1 Lines 10.2 Introduction to Conics: Parabolas 10.3 Ellipses 10.4 Hyperbolas 10.5 Rotation of Conics 10.6 Parametric Equations 10.7 Polar Coordinates 10.8 Graphs of Polar Equations 10.9 Polar Equations of Conics 11. Analytic Geometry in Three Dimensions 11.1 The Three-Dimensional Coordinate System 11.2 Vectors in Space 11.3 The Cross Product of Two Vectors 11.4 Lines and Planes in Space 12. Limits and an Introduction to Calculus 12.1 Introduction to Limits 12.2 Techniques for Evaluating Limits 12.3 The Tangent Line Problem 12.4 Limits at Infinity and Limits of Sequences 12.5 The Area Problem Cumulative Test: Chapters 10–12 Appendix A. Review of Fundamental Concepts of Algebra A.1 Real Numbers and Their Properties A.2 Exponents and Radicals A.3 Polynomials and Factoring A.4 Rational Expressions A.5 Solving Equations A.6 Linear Inequalities in One Variable A.7 Errors and the Algebra of Calculus Appendix B. Concepts in Statistics (web) B.1 Representing Data B.2 Measures of Central Tendency and Dispersion B.3 Least Squares Regression
SynopsisThis market-leading text continues to provide both students and instructors with sound, consistently structured explanations of the mathematical concepts. Designed for a one- or two-term course that prepares students to study calculus, the new Seventh Edition retains the features that have made Precalculus a complete solution for both students and instructors: interesting applications, cutting-edge design, and innovative technology combined with an abundance of carefully written exercises.
